NCDC Measles Situation Report, Serial Number 05, Data as at May 31st 2024

Attachments

HIGHLIGHTS

In May, 2024:

‒ Borno (329), Katsina (58), Osun (33), Bayelsa(30), Ogun (30), and Oyo (29) accounted for 62.92% of the 809 suspected cases reported

‒ Of the suspected cases reported, 348 (43.02%) were confirmed (28 lab-confirmed, 0 epidemiologically linked, 320 clinically compatible), 242 (29.91%) were discarded & 219 (27.07%) were pending

‒ A total of 228 LGAs across 28 States + FCT reported at least one suspected case

‒ Two (2) deaths was recorded from confirmed cases

From January – May, 2024:

‒ Borno (4,273), Katsina (429), Osun (399), Lagos (387), Bauchi (374), Ogun (349), and Yobe (346) accounted for 60.32% of the 10,870 suspected cases reported

‒ Of the suspected cases reported, 5,645 (51.93%) were confirmed (1,248 lab-confirmed & 2,085 epidemiologically linked, 2,312 clinically compatible), 4,190 (38.55%) were discarded & 1,035 (9.52%) were pending

‒ The age group 9 - 59 months accounted for 2775 (64.3%) of all confirmed cases

‒ A total of 39 deaths (CFR = 0.69%) were recorded among confirmed cases

‒ Up to 4,066 (72.0%) of the 5,645 confirmed cases did not receive any dose of measles vaccine (“zero doses”)

Measles outbreaks as at May 31st 2024:

‒ By end of May (epi-week 23 of 2024), a total of 263 LGAs across 36 States have recorded measles outbreaks

‒ Osun had the highest number of LGAs (15) that have experience measles outbreak this year. Followed by Bauchi and Adamawa with 14 LGAs each.

‒ Furthermore, 236 LGAs across 36 States have ended their measles outbreak as at epi-week 23

‒ Osun (14), Bauchi (13) and Ekiti (13) have the highest number of LGAs that have ended their outbreak this year.

‒ By end of May 2024, 24 LGAs across 14 States still have ongoing measles outbreak.

‒ Three (3) LGAs (Argungu, Kafur, and Nganzi) recorded new measles outbreak in epi-week 23
